WebFeb 19, 2024 · Option 2: Edit the MySQL Configuration File. MySQL settings can be changed by editing the main my.cnf configuration file. Open the file for editing: sudo nano /etc/mysql/my.cnf. Scroll down to the [mysqld] section, and find the default-time-zone = "+00:00" line.
